Cost Breakdown of Testosterone Replacement Therapy in the UK
When thinking about TRT, expenses can differ based on several factors, including the format of the treatment (injections, gels, or spots), whether the treatment is gotten through the NHS or personal health care, and additional monitoring or consultations. Below is a detailed table describing the cost breakdown for TRT in the UK.
Type of TreatmentNHS CostPrivate Provider CostPreliminary ConsultationFree (with GP recommendation)₤ 100 - ₤ 250Testosterone InjectionsTypically totally free₤ 30 - ₤ 100 per injectionTestosterone Gels/PatchesPotentially totally free₤ 30 - ₤ 60 each monthBlood TestsNormally complimentary₤ 50 - ₤ 100 per testContinuous ConsultationsFree (NHS)₤ 50 - ₤ 150 per visitTotal Monthly Cost₤ 0 (NHS)₤ 110 - ₤ 250NHS vs. Private Costs
NHS: In the UK, patients who receive testosterone treatment can often access the treatment through the National Health Service (NHS) at little to no direct cost. The patient must initially consult their GP, who can refer them to an endocrinologist or urologist for evaluation and treatment.

Private: Private treatment can be considerably more pricey. Not just exists an initial consultation charge, but patients might likewise be responsible for the cost of the medication, blood tests, and follow-up assessments. This can add up to a considerable regular monthly expenditure.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)1. For how long does TRT take to show results?
Many clients start to notice improvements within a few weeks, though complete benefits can take several months to manifest.
2. Exist any dangers included with TRT?
While TRT is usually safe for many clients, it can carry dangers consisting of increased red blood cell count, acne, sleep apnea, and, sometimes, an increased risk of cardiovascular concerns. It's important to have comprehensive discussions with a health care supplier.
3. Can anybody get TRT?
No, TRT is generally advised just for guys detected with low testosterone levels through blood tests and medical assessments.
